Financial Alliance Formed with Honda
-The Company announced that it has finalized the payment date on March 23, relating to the already announced issuance of new shares through a third-party allotment to Honda Motor Co., Ltd. In its core business of car electronics, the Company will promote the OEM business with Honda. 14,700,000 shares of common stock will be issued to Honda to raise 2,481,250,000 yen, which will be applied to R&D expenses as operating funds. After the issuance, Honda will be the second largest shareholder of Pioneer with 4.50% shareholding ratio, after Sharp Corp. with 9.19%. -The Company announced that it will move its head office from Meguro Ward, Tokyo to its existing office in Saiwai Ward, Kawasaki City, Kanagawa Pref. Operation at the new headquarters will begin on Nov. 24, 2009. With this move, the company will complete its project to integrate its five main operating bases in the Kanto region into two locations, namely to Kawasaki City and Kawagoe City in Saitama Pref. The current headquarters facility in Tokyo is scheduled to be sold off after the transfer. Recent Developments Outside Japan
-The Company announced that it has reached a cross-license agreement with Honeywell International Inc. in the area of automotive and portable GPS navigation devices. The agreement gives them the right to use each company's patented technologies in the field. Although the Company filed a complaint against Honeywell in the U.S. in Nov. for infringing the Company's navigation patents, this agreement will terminate the matter. (From an article in the Nikkan Jidosha Shimbun on Dec. 21, 2009)-The Company and Shanghai Automotive Industry Corporation (Group) (SAIC) announced that they have established a joint-venture company for the purpose of expanding their car navigation business in China. The new company, Anyo Pioneer Motor Information Technology Co., Ltd., will provide OE car navigation systems and establish traffic information systems for the Chinese market, aiming to generate more than 1.5 billion yuan in sales in the fifth year. In the medium- and long-term perspective, it will work on establishing an extremely low cost car navigation device. Anyo Pioneer Motor Information Technology, which will be headquartered in Shanghai, will be capitalized at 90 million yuan, with 51 percent invested by the SAIC Group and 49 percent by Pioneer China Holding Co., Ltd. Functions of the joint-venture company will include planning, development, and distribution of car navigation products in China, which will be combined with the Company's manufacturing, software development, and map database editing capabilities, fully covering operations required for leading the car navigation market in China. -The Company announced a medium-term management plan through Mar. 31, 2012 to undertake full efforts on restructuring measures. The company will work to build stronger operations for the car electronics business as a core business through enhanced alliance with automakers and other companies. To streamline the Group, it will force through structural reforms, including reorganization of operational bases and personnel downsizing. The Company aims to raise the ratio in the sales amount by the car electronics business to over 80% in the fiscal year ending Mar. 2012, from approx. 60% in the fiscal year ending Mar. 2009. Photoremo@Navi Ver1.0-The Company and Sharp Corporation announced that they have jointly developed the Photoremo@Navi Ver1.0, a new data standard for communications between mobile phones and car navigation systems. The Photoremo, which was named based on the "remote control by photo (images)"concept, enables transfer of images in JPEG format with additional control information. The two companies intend to employ the versatile JPEG system to make communication between a wider range of digital equipment possible. The new development adds cutting-edge technology to the Company's car navigation products, while marking Sharp's first entry into the in-vehicle electric equipment business. The two companies look to market the Photoremo@Navi program to other car navigation suppliers as well. (From an article in the Nikkan Jidosha Shimbun on Apr. 15, 2009)
